文摘为探索和证明透明进程间通信协议TIPC(Transparent Inter Process Communication Protocol)[1]在进程间数据传输的优势,首先简单介绍了透明通信协议TIPC的结构和优点,然后在节点间和节点内分别对基于TCP协议和TIPC协议通信性能进行全面的测量,并针对测量数据给出详细的分析.所得出的结果不仅对并行程序设计中数据包大小的选取具有很强的指导意义,而且对并行程序设计环境底层通信协议的选取也给出了科学的依据,从而达到优化并行程序设计、提高应用程序执行效率的目的.
文摘Tierui Zhang(张铁锐)Prof.Tierui Zhang is a Full Professor at the Technical Institute of Physics and Chemistry(TIPC),Chinese Acad-emy of Sciences(CAS).He obtained his Ph.D.degree in chemistry in 2003 at Jilin University,China.He then worked as a Postdoctoral Researcher in the labs of Prof.Markus Antonietti(Max Planck Insti-tute of Colloids and Interfaces,Germany),Prof.Charl F.J.Faul(Max Planck Institute of Colloids and Interfaces,Germany),Prof.Hicham Fenniri(University of Alberta,Canada),Prof.Z.Ryan Tian(University of Arkansas,USA),Prof.Yadong Yin(University of California,River-side,USA),and Prof.Yushan Yan(University ofCalifornia,Riverside;currently at the University of Delaware,USA).His current scientific interests focus on catalyst nanoma-terials for energy conversion.
